Why "Split/Gender"?

        When I originally created this blog I was deeply interested in gender and Judith Butler. I still create work which relates back to this theme, but  I have made it a little less obvious. "Hysteria" actually refers back to this older work. The piece "Miracle" relates to those who were born without a uterus, and "Snipped" relates to those who got hysterectomy. "Miracle" can be someone who was born intersex and "Snipped" may be someone who is in the process of getting SRS (Sexual Reassignment Surgery).
